2018-05-04 17:57:46 +02:00
|
|
|
<?php
|
|
|
|
|
|
|
|
include_once __DIR__.'/../../core.php';
|
|
|
|
|
|
|
|
switch (post('op')) {
|
|
|
|
case 'add':
|
|
|
|
$idmastrino = get_new_idmastrino('co_movimenti_modelli');
|
|
|
|
$descrizione = post('descrizione');
|
2019-04-11 16:04:08 +02:00
|
|
|
$nome = post('nome');
|
2018-05-04 17:57:46 +02:00
|
|
|
|
2018-07-19 15:33:32 +02:00
|
|
|
for ($i = 0; $i < sizeof(post('idconto')); ++$i) {
|
2018-05-04 17:57:46 +02:00
|
|
|
$idconto = post('idconto')[$i];
|
2019-04-12 01:11:32 +02:00
|
|
|
if (!empty($idconto)) {
|
2019-04-11 16:04:08 +02:00
|
|
|
$query = 'INSERT INTO co_movimenti_modelli(idmastrino, nome, descrizione, idconto) VALUES('.prepare($idmastrino).', '.prepare($nome).', '.prepare($descrizione).', '.prepare($idconto).')';
|
|
|
|
if ($dbo->query($query)) {
|
|
|
|
$id_record = $idmastrino;
|
|
|
|
}
|
2018-05-04 17:57:46 +02:00
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
break;
|
|
|
|
|
|
|
|
case 'editriga':
|
|
|
|
$idmastrino = post('idmastrino');
|
|
|
|
$descrizione = post('descrizione');
|
2019-04-11 16:04:08 +02:00
|
|
|
$nome = post('nome');
|
2018-05-04 17:57:46 +02:00
|
|
|
|
|
|
|
// Eliminazione prima nota
|
|
|
|
$dbo->query('DELETE FROM co_movimenti_modelli WHERE idmastrino='.prepare($idmastrino));
|
|
|
|
|
2018-07-19 15:33:32 +02:00
|
|
|
for ($i = 0; $i < sizeof(post('idconto')); ++$i) {
|
2018-05-04 17:57:46 +02:00
|
|
|
$idconto = post('idconto')[$i];
|
2019-04-12 01:11:32 +02:00
|
|
|
if (!empty($idconto)) {
|
|
|
|
$query = 'INSERT INTO co_movimenti_modelli(idmastrino, nome, descrizione, idconto) VALUES('.prepare($idmastrino).', '.prepare($nome).', '.prepare($descrizione).', '.prepare($idconto).')';
|
2019-04-11 16:04:08 +02:00
|
|
|
if ($dbo->query($query)) {
|
|
|
|
$id_record = $idmastrino;
|
|
|
|
}
|
2018-05-04 17:57:46 +02:00
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
break;
|
|
|
|
|
|
|
|
case 'delete':
|
|
|
|
$idmastrino = post('idmastrino');
|
|
|
|
|
2018-05-11 15:56:08 +02:00
|
|
|
if (!empty($idmastrino)) {
|
2018-05-04 17:57:46 +02:00
|
|
|
// Eliminazione prima nota
|
|
|
|
$dbo->query('DELETE FROM co_movimenti_modelli WHERE idmastrino='.prepare($idmastrino));
|
|
|
|
|
2018-07-19 17:29:21 +02:00
|
|
|
flash()->info(tr('Movimento eliminato!'));
|
2018-05-04 17:57:46 +02:00
|
|
|
}
|
2018-05-11 15:56:08 +02:00
|
|
|
|
2018-05-04 17:57:46 +02:00
|
|
|
break;
|
|
|
|
}
|